description We suggest a convenient method based on the Fibonacci polynomials and the collocation points for solving approximately the Abel’s integral equation of second kind. Initially, the solution is supposed in the form of the Fibonacci polynomials truncated series with the unknown coefficients. Then, by placing this series into the main problem and collocating the resulting equation at some points, a system of algebraic equations is obtained. After solving it, the unknown coefficients and so the solution of main problem are determined. The error analysis is discussed elaborately. Also, the reliability of the method is quantified through numerical examples.
